A História da Lógica de Programação

4491 palavras 18 páginas
A História da lógica de programação

A lógica da programação é, sem dúvida, a primeira coisa que deve ser estudada se você quiser se tornar um bom programador, seja qual for a linguagem. Porque ela é tão importante? Imagine que agora você é um soldado que recebe ordens e as coloca em prática. O seu capitão lhe diz: “Soldado, sua missão é encontrar a arma principal do inimigo e sabotá-la, como também fazer o reconhecimento do local. Assim que você se infiltrar, vai procurar colher o máximo possível de informações. No entanto, antes das 14:00 deve sair do local. Se observar alguma movimentação suspeita, saia imediatamente. E lembre-se, sua missão principal é encontrar a arma principal do inimigo e sabotá-la.” Nessa missão, o soldado precisa sempre se lembrar das ordens do capitão, e para que ela seja bem sucedida é necessário ele aplicar todas elas. Vamos analisar essa missão:
Objetivos principal: Encontrar e sabotar a arma principal do inimigo.
Objetivo secundário: Colher o máximo de informações possíveis.
Condições: O soldado só vai terminar a missão com êxito se: Não houver nenhuma movimentação suspeita, que faça com que ele saia do local antes do horário, e, caso isso não ocorra, ele deve sair de lá sem falta as 14:00.
Quando vamos programar, devemos ser como o comandante. Primeiro, devemos saber qual o objetivo principal e daí programar as suas condições para que esse objetivo seja atingido. Veja o caso dessa tirinha:

*Claro que o marido levou o que a mulher falou ao pé da letra. Sabemos que no dia-a-dia ninguém leva tudo ao pé da letra. No entanto, essa tirinha não representa o cotidiano. Ela representa o modo de se pensar ao programar.
Notou? A condição, por assim dizer, não foi bem “programada” pela esposa, levando o marido a trazer nove ovos, aos invés de seis ovos e nove batatas, que era o que a esposa gostaria que ele trouxesse. Ela deveria ter dito assim: Me traga seis ovos. Se tiver batatas, me traga nove batatas.
A lógica da programação é

Relacionados

  • LÓGICA
    1668 palavras | 7 páginas
  • Projeto de pesquisa (metodologia)
    1657 palavras | 7 páginas
  • Shunt
    8238 palavras | 33 páginas
  • Trabalho de L.P.
    2397 palavras | 10 páginas
  • Lógica de programção
    1280 palavras | 6 páginas
  • Logica de programação
    1578 palavras | 7 páginas
  • Logica de programação
    1721 palavras | 7 páginas
  • Dominios de programação
    2029 palavras | 9 páginas
  • Construção de Algoritmos
    718 palavras | 3 páginas
  • Quando Surgiram Os Primeiros Programadores
    1075 palavras | 5 páginas